| Every
Child Matters
Every Child Matters: Change for Children is a shared programme
of change to improve outcomes for all children and young people.
It takes forward the Government’s vision of radical reform
for children, young people and families.
Children and young people have told us that five outcomes
are key to well-being in childhood and later life: being healthy,
staying safe, enjoying and achieving, making a positive contribution
and achieving economic well-being. The programme aims to improve
those outcomes for all children and to close the gap in outcomes
between the disadvantaged and their peers.
The new Children Act 2004 provides the legal framework for
the programme of reform. Every Child Matters: Change for Children
published in December 2004, brings together all the ways we
are working towards improved outcomes for children, young people
and families into a national framework for 150 local-authority-led
change programmes.
